Sergi Roberto will miss two very important games for Barcelona. The club have confirmed the injury in his right adductor muscle this Sunday.
The footballer was going to be key for Quique Setien in the match against Napoli and in the Clasico, where he usually shines, but he will miss both matches.
According to the Barca statement, Sergi Roberto will be out for around three to four weeks. The coach will have to change his plans for two key matches for the side.
It was expected that the player who came through the La Masia academy would act as a "false winger" in both matches to reinforce the midfield. Setien played him in that position against Athletic Bilbao in the Copa del Rey, he will have to come up with an alternative plan.
Against Eibar, in a league match which Barca won easily, it was Arturo Vidal who strenghened the midfield and he played in the hole behind Leo Messi and Antoine Griezmann, movely freely in attack.
That could be option chosen by Quique Setien for the important matches at San Paolo and the Santiago Bernabeu.
